‘Traffic-Light’ Dashboard Lets PwC in UK Monitor Office Attendance

Summary by Irish Times
Big Four firm checks building pass swipes and WiFi connections to address ‘persistent and deliberate non-compliance’

Consulting and accounting firm PwC uses Wi-Fi to monitor whether its UK-based staff are in the office enough. They also monitor how often each person uses their access pass.
